Nelson Mandela's Reading List

The 5 books that shaped Nelson Mandelaanti-apartheid leader & president.

Read voraciously during 27 years of imprisonment and emerged to lead South Africa toward reconciliation.

Influential Books

Long Walk to Freedom

Long Walk to Freedom

Nelson Mandela(1994)

Mandela's autobiography — 27 years in prison and the triumph of reconciliation over revenge.

Invictus

Invictus

William Ernest Henley(1888)

The poem Mandela recited in prison — "I am the master of my fate, I am the captain of my soul."

The Complete Works of Shakespeare

The Complete Works of Shakespeare

William Shakespeare(1623)

The "Robben Island Bible" — a smuggled Shakespeare shared among prisoners. Mandela marked passages from Julius Caesar.

Wretched of the Earth

Wretched of the Earth

Frantz Fanon(1961)

Fanon's analysis of colonialism influenced Mandela's early militancy before he turned to reconciliation.

An Autobiography: The Story of My Experiments with Truth

An Autobiography: The Story of My Experiments with Truth

Mahatma Gandhi(1927)

Gandhi's influence on Mandela was immense — both men chose nonviolence as a strategy and a moral stance.
